Mr. F. Sutherland, 0.B.F., who has for
many years been Shipping Manager for Messrs. Jardine
Matheson & Company here, desires to lay before the
Board of Trade an invention for signalling at sea,
which may prove of great value to ships plying on the
China Coast under existing conditions.
The device has been examined by the Naval
Authorities here, and they are disposed to agree as
to its value.
I am therefore directed to enquire whether
arrangements could be made for Mr. Sutherland, who
carries this letter, to submit details of the invention
to the appropriate authorities.
